IDR is seeking a Technical Product Owner to join one of our top clients for an opportunity in Rochester, Minnesota. This role is vital for aligning business objectives with Agile delivery within a healthcare or laboratory environment, focusing on digital products and workflows.
Position Overview for the Technical Product Owner:
- Act as the primary business representative to the Scrum team, ensuring alignment between business goals and Agile delivery
- Define and maintain the product vision, roadmap, and release plans
- Prioritize and manage the product backlog, writing and refining user stories and acceptance criteria
- Serve as a liaison between stakeholders and development teams, facilitating communication and understanding
- Participate in Agile ceremonies and approve completed work to ensure quality and alignment
Requirements for the Technical Product Owner:
- Bachelor’s Degree
- Experience in Digital Access & Enablement – Communications Digital product experience
- Strong Agile/Scrum expertise and stakeholder communication skills
- Certification in Scrum Product Owner within 1 year if not already obtained
- Experience in healthcare and/or laboratory environments, including EPIC API experience
